    Hanna, roughly, my post is about success of the True Finns party on the recent elections in Finland.
    This party, though being left-wing, expresses nationalistic views (basically 'Finland is for the Finns'), it strongly opposes immigration and also they object helping Portugal and Greece to overcome their financial problems at their costs (they drink vine and dance all the time while we have to work in severe North - why must we help them?).
    Also I mentioned recent successes of right-wing parties in Austria and Hungary and also I stated that Jean-Marie Le Pen in France now is more popular than Nicolas Sarkozy.
    There are many people in Germany (including the politicians), as I heard, who also fight against helping Greece and Portugal at the moment and generally - against being a 'donor' for poor European economies.
    I concluded that if this tendency spreads there will be no future for EU.
